Restaurants nearby St Andrews Hall, Chase side, London, Southgate N14 5PP, United Kingdom



Thalassa

Approximately 0.03 km away
Address: 110-112 Chase Side, Southgate, London N14 5PH

Thalassa Seafood & Steak Restaurant & Bar

Approximately 0.03 km away
Address: 110-112 Chase Side, London N14 5PH, United Kingdom

Fantozzi

Approximately 0.06 km away
Address: 100-102 Chase Side, London N14 5PH, United Kingdom

Fantozzi

Approximately 0.06 km away
Address: 100-102 Chase Side, Southgate, London N14 5PH

Nurjenna

Approximately 0.08 km away
Address: 86 Chase Side, Southgate, London N14 5PH

Pizza Express

Approximately 0.08 km away
Address: 94-98 Chase Side, London N14 5PH, United Kingdom

Nurjenna

Approximately 0.1 km away
Address: 86 Chase Side, London N14 5PH, United Kingdom

The New Crown

Approximately 0.11 km away
Address: 80-84 Chase Side, Southgate, London N14 5PH

KFC

Approximately 0.14 km away
Address: 47 Chase Side, London N14 5BP, United Kingdom

Myra

Approximately 0.17 km away
Address: 60 Chase Side, Southgate, London N14 5PA

McDonald's Chase Side

Approximately 0.2 km away
Address: 31-33 Chase Side, London N14 5BP, United Kingdom

Oriental Chef

Approximately 0.25 km away
Address: 36 Chase Side, Southgate, London N14 5PA

The Fish & Chips Co.

Approximately 0.26 km away
Address: 11 Chase Side, Osidge, London N14 5BP, United Kingdom

The Fish & Chips Co

Approximately 0.26 km away
Address: 11 Chase Side, Southgate, London N14 5BP

Honeymoon

Approximately 0.28 km away
Address: 84 Crown Lane, Southgate, London N14 5EN